- Expansion of multi-use path on Route 130 to continue on from Pickerel Cove Road to the <br /> Sandwich Town line. <br /> - Secure feasibility study regarding use of Town Landfill cap area located on Ashers Path for <br /> additional recreation use. <br /> - Establish carry-in boat access and parking area on Pickerel Cove (Mashpee—Wakeby Pond) on <br /> Camp Vin-haven property. <br /> - Working with Mass. Division of Fisheries & Wildlife, re-establish natural wetlands in former <br /> cranberry bogs along Santuit River in Santuit Pond Preserve. <br /> Year 4 <br /> - Town acquisition of the 7.4 acre Johnson property (Map 36, Blocks, 33 and 34) for conservation <br /> to link adjacent Town and Water District properties. The Cross-Cap�e Trail. would then be moved <br /> from its temporary location on Goodspeed's Meetinghouse Road to a new footpath across the <br /> parcels and the Als,Property/Noisy Hole Conservation Area, <br /> - Acquisition of 23.6 acre Jordan property(Map 51, Block 6) as addition to Quashuet Woodlands <br /> in MNWR). <br /> - Acquisition of 8.7 acre Wilbur property (Map 92, Block 2) by Town of Mashpee, state, <br /> Falmouth Rod & Gun Club and/or USF&WS to complete protection of that portion of the <br /> National Wildlife Refuge. <br /> - Possible set-aside of conservation lands at Quashnet River, Trout Pond and/ or South Mashpee <br /> Pine Barrens as part of Mashpee Commons project permitting, transfer of development rights or <br /> purchases (Map'68, Blocks 5 and 6, Map 73, Blocks, 6 and 12, parts of Map 74, Block '16, Map <br /> 75, Block 1., part of Map 75, Block 10, Map 99, Blocks 34, 35, 36 and 37 and Map 104, Block <br /> 102). <br /> - Development of temporary National Wildlife Refuge visitors center by USF&WS and / or <br /> Friends of the Mashpee NWR. <br /> - Development of Santuit. Pond Conservation Area parking and trail system by Conservation <br /> Corps and DPW. <br /> - Development of Childs, River Conservation Area parking and trail system by Conservation <br /> Corps and DPW. <br /> - Develop Mashpee Leisure Services summer day camp facilities at Car�p Vinhaven, adjacent to <br /> carry in boat access, including potential swimming facilities on Pickerel Cove. <br /> - Update Mashpee River Woodlands and Johns, Pond park Management Plans. <br /> 9-7 <br />
